Factors Affecting Cost
- Length of the Line: Longer lines require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Type of Property: Commercial installations often cost more than residential ones due to the complexity and scale.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.
- Type of Soil: Rocky or difficult soil conditions can complicate the installation process, leading to higher costs.
- Accessibility: Easier access to the installation site can lower labor costs, while difficult-to-reach areas may increase them.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ials may have a higher upfront cost but offer better longevity and safety.
- Labor Rates: Local labor costs in Gilbert, AZ, can vary, impacting the total installation c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(in Gilbert, AZ) |
---|---|
Basic Residential Installation | $500 - $1,500 |
Commercial Installation |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Permit Fees | $50 - $200 |
Trenching Costs | $4 - $12 per linear foot |
Pipe Material (per foot) | $1 - $3 |
Labor Costs (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
Pressure Testing | $100 - $300 |
